Background Information: The four human glycoprotein hormones (chorionic gonadotropin, luteinizing hormone, follicle stimulating hormone, and thyroid stimulating hormone) are dimers consisting of alpha and beta subunits. The alpha subunits of these hormones are identical, while they each have unique beta subunits that allow the hormones to bind specific receptors on target cells to activate distinct downstream signaling pathways. This product represents the isolated alpha subunit from human chorionic gonadotropin purified from pregnant female urine.
